In the United States, there are over a thousand casinos and the number continues to rise. Many states have legalized casino gambling, but some are more restricted than others. The Las Vegas Valley has the highest concentration of casinos, followed by the New York metropolitan area, Atlantic City, and the Chicago region. There are also many riverboat casinos and tribal casinos in the United States.

While a casino may not be a high-risk place for crime, it does require a strong level of security. Casinos use elaborate surveillance systems to keep watch over patrons and the games themselves. Security employees are trained to monitor patron behavior and look for blatant cheating. Additionally, they have pit bosses and table managers who monitor betting patterns. These employees are also tracked by higher-up personnel to ensure that their actions are consistent.
